3:1  On account of this I, Paul, the prisoner of Christ Jesus for the sake of you Gentiles
3:2  —if indeed you have heard about the stewardship of God’s grace given to me for you.
3:3  According to revelation the mystery was made known to me, just as I wrote beforehand in brief,
3:4  so that you may be able when you read to understand my insight into the mystery of Christ
3:5  (which in other generations was not made known to the sons of men as it has now been revealed to his holy apostles and prophets by the Spirit):
3:6  that the Gentiles are fellow heirs, and fellow members of the body, and fellow sharers of the promise in Christ Jesus through the gospel,
3:7  of which I became a servant, according to the gift of God’s grace given to me, according to the working of his power.
3:8  To me, the least of all the saints, was given this grace: to proclaim the good news of the fathomless riches of Christ to the Gentiles,
3:9  and to enlighten everyone as to what is the administration of the mystery hidden from the ages by God, who created all things,
3:10  in order that the many-sided wisdom of God might be made known now to the rulers and the authorities in the heavenly places through the church,
3:11  according to the purpose of the ages which he carried out in Christ Jesus our Lord,
3:12  in whom we have boldness and access in confidence through faith in him.
3:13  Therefore I ask you not to be discouraged at my afflictions on behalf of you, which are your glory.
3:14  On account of this, I bend my knees before the Father,
3:15  from whom every family in heaven and on earth is named,
3:16  that he may grant you according to the riches of his glory to be strengthened with power through his Spirit in the inner person,
3:17  that Christ may dwell in your hearts through faith (you having been firmly rooted and established in love),
3:18  in order that you may be strong enough to grasp together with all the saints what is the breadth, and length, and height, and depth,
3:19  and to know the love of Christ that surpasses knowledge, in order that you may be filled up to all the fullness of God.
3:20  Now to the one who is able to do beyond all measure more than all that we ask or think, according to the power that is at work in us,
3:21  to him be the glory in the church and in Christ Jesus to all generations forever and ever. Amen.
